          Tragically, time for an update on a possible squad for next season. This is based on the 2021 squad and what we know publicly about departures and signings via media releases, plus rumoured new signings. Players in italics would be most at risk of not being re-signed. I've also suggested a few likely replacements.

          Hookers:
          Samisoni Taukei’aho (signed until 2024)
          Bradley Slater
          Nathan Harris Tyrone Thompson

          Props:
          Aidan Ross (to 2023)
          Ollie Norris
          Reuben O’Neill
          Angus Ta’avao (to 2021)
          Sione Mafileo (to 2022)
          Atunaisa Moli (it will be hard to justify continual selection of a player who sadly is always injured)

          Locks:
          Brodie Retallick (to 2023)
          Tupou Vaa’i (to 2023)
          Naitoa Ah Kuoi (to 2023)
          Josh Lord
          Laghlan McWhannell (I would keep him because depth is important, as the Chiefs will know)

          Loose Forwards:
          Sam Cane
          Luke Jacobson
          Pita Gus Sowakula (to 2023)
          Samipeni Finau (to 2024)
          Kaylum Boshier
          Lachlan Boshier Tom Florence
          Mitchell Brown
          Mitchell Karpik
          Simon Parker (one of these two could be retained, but unlikely both)

          Halfbacks:
          Brad Weber (to 2023)
          Xavier Roe (to 2022)
          Te Toiroa Tahuriorangi Cortez Ratima

          First five-eighths:
          Bryn Gatland (to 2023)
          Rivez Reihana Josh Ioane (2022 only)
          Kaleb Trask

          Midfielders:
          Anton Lienert-Brown (to 2023)
          Quinn Tupaea (to 2023)
          Alex Nankivell
          Bailyn Sullivan Tei Walden

          Outside backs:
          Jonah Lowe
          Damian McKenzie Emoni Narawa
          Etene Nanai-Seturo (to 2022)
          Shaun Stevenson (to 2023)
          Chase Tiatia (to 2022)
          Sean Wainui Gideon Wrampling

          That would be 38 players.

                                      There would only be 8 loose forwards in the squad I posted. Cane, Jacobson, PGS, Finau and 4 others. Brown will likely be the 5th but I don't see him as a starter.

                                      K Boshier might be better used as a 7 as he isn't the biggest no.8 around, but is more physical and robust than Karpik. Florence can play 6 and 7, and has a high workrate. Both Boshier and Florence can back up Cane. Then it comes down to the last loose forward (Karpik/Parker/A. N. Other). Parker has the size and potential to be a really good no.8. He needs to get over his injuries though.

                                      So selecting another winger means one less lock (no McWhannell) or only 3 specialist midfielders. Both seem risky options.
